Help with Classic Army G36 K

Hey I need some help on disassembling my rifle, I have a Classic Army G36 K that I bought a few years ago. I started letting my brother take it to airsoft, and he buggered it up last time.

The hopup that is located with in the faux shell ejection port has come off its rail. In order to fix this I need to take the gun apart, which was easy except for the pin holding it together where the magazine fits in. Can anyone give me some tips on getting this peg out?

All the others just slid out or screwed out, this one doe not budge.

